Art. 35 DMA
Annual reporting
- The Commission shall submit to the European Parliament and to the Council an annual report on the implementation of this Regulation and the progress made towards achieving its objectives.
- The report referred to in paragraph 1 shall include:
(a) a summary of the Commission’s activities including any adopted measures or decisions and ongoing market investigations in connection with this Regulation;
(b) the findings resulting from the monitoring of the implementation by the gatekeepers of the obligations under this Regulation;
(c) an assessment of the audited description referred to in Article 15;
(d) an overview of the cooperation between the Commission and national authorities in connection with this Regulation;
(e) an overview of the activities and tasks performed by the High Level Group of Digital Regulators, including how its recommendations as regards the enforcement of this Regulation are to be implemented. - The Commission shall publish the report on its website.
